Chhibbar Vishal sold $176K of EXLS

Chhibbar Vishal (Executive Vice President) sold 5,000 shares of ExlService Holdings, Inc. (EXLS) at $35.10 ($0.18M total) on 2026-08-11.

ExlService Holdings (EXLS) Is Up 7.8% After Securing New US$1 Billion Credit Facility - What's Changed

ExlService Holdings (EXLS) stock rose 7.8% after securing a new $1 billion credit facility, replacing its prior $600 million facility. The new agreement includes a $600 million revolving credit line and a $400 million term loan maturing in 2031. The company plans to use the funds for acquisitions and AI investments, aiming for $3.2 billion revenue and $374.5 million earnings by 2029.

ExlService (EXL) Soars 17.88%, Wins Hedge Fund Confidence

ExlService Holdings (EXLS) rose 17.88% to close at $35.99 after Q2 results and a positive outlook. Q2 revenue was $594.76 million, up 15.6% y/y, with net income $64.5 million. FY26 guidance: $2.39B to $2.415B revenue and adjusted EPS $2.25 to $2.29. Needham raised its price target to $45 from $40.

EXL (NASDAQ:EXLS) Surprises With Strong Q2 CY2026, Full

ExlService Holdings (NASDAQ:EXLS) reported Q2 CY2026 revenue of $594.8 million, up 15.6% year on year, beating Wall Street estimates. Full-year revenue guidance was $2.40 billion at the midpoint, 3.1% above analysts’ expectations. Non-GAAP EPS was $0.59, 7.8% above consensus. The stock rose 2.3% to $31.25 after the release.
